Stoke Newington station offers a range of facilities to ensure a smooth travel experience. Although the ticket office is open only for a short period on weekdays, ticket machines are available, making it convenient to buy and collect tickets on the go. For those purchasing online, you can easily collect your tickets from these machines. An induction loop is available to assist those with hearing aids.
While Stoke Newington station provides some level of accessibility, such as accessible ticket machines and seating areas, it's important to note that there is no step-free access or ramps for train access. Travelers with mobility concerns may need to plan accordingly. Unfortunately, facilities such as toilets, baby changing areas, and waiting rooms are not available here, but there is CCTV throughout the station for added security.
Stoke Newington station is well connected with various transport links. For those looking to travel beyond the station, you can find a taxi office conveniently located just outside. Additionally, there are rail replacement services using local buses during downtime, with stops situated strategically for northbound services to Enfield Town and Cheshunt and southbound services to Liverpool Street.

Watford Junction is designed with the traveler in mind, offering a host of facilities to ensure a seamless journey. The ticket office is operational from 5:30 AM to 11:00 PM every day except Sunday when it opens at 6:30 AM—ideal for early risers and night owls alike. If you've purchased tickets online, you can conveniently collect them at the ticket machines located in the booking hall. For those requiring assistance, an induction loop is available, enhancing accessibility for travelers with hearing aids.
Step-free access throughout the station ensures it is user-friendly for all, including individuals with reduced mobility. Accessible toilets operated with a RADAR key are available, and assistance can be booked in advance for anyone needing extra help. For those using wheeled transport, ramps are available for train access, and there's a dedicated area with 19 accessible parking spaces in the car park.
As you await your train, enjoy a variety of refreshment facilities available on-site. Grab a quick bite or a cup of coffee from one of the shops, and find an ATM machine for any last-minute cash needs. Although there is no public Wi-Fi, the fully stocked amenities ensure a comfortable wait. Unfortunately, there is no waiting room service, but seating areas are available.
One of the key attributes of Watford Junction is its extensive transport links. Should your journey require bus services, rail replacement buses operate from Bus Stop 1, and detailed onward travel information can be printed from available resources. There's even a direct bus connection to Heathrow Airport, making international travel hassle-free. Taxis and car hire services are readily accessible, ensuring you have multiple travel options at your disposal.
